The Cost of a Replacement Car Key

It can be a hassle to lose your car keys. But it's important to remember that a replacement key might not be as expensive as you think.

The cost of a replacement for a car key depends on several aspects, including the type of key you need and the location of your home. Keys that are traditional are the cheapest replacement car keys, while smart keys are the most expensive.

Cost of the parts

Based on the type of key you require, the cost can differ. Keys with transponder chips that are standard are priced from $50 to $110. The costs increase when you require keys equipped with a transponder chip or a push-to start vehicle that requires a second fob to turn on the car. Those types of keys are costly to duplicate or replace and are harder for car thieves to gain access to.

The cost is also affected by the year, make and type of vehicle you own. The transponder chip on newer vehicles will need to be programmed with an auto locksmith or dealer. That means that the spare key needs to be programmed to work with the car, which can add up to $200. Other factors that affect the cost of replacement keys include:

Cost of Labor

The cost of replacing a car key will depend on the kind you require. For less than $10, a traditional double-edged key can be duplicated at an area hardware store. However, more advanced keys require special equipment to design and manufacture. This can significantly increase the cost of replacing keys for cars.

If your car has the key fob to unlock and start the vehicle, you'll need install a new fob as well. The cost can be up to $200, depending on the make and model. Additionally, many newer vehicles also use a transponder chip inside the key that needs to be replaced and programmed in order to work properly. This is a cost that is difficult to estimate before the key is lost and needs to be replaced.

A cutting machine with specialized capabilities is also required to make the new replacement key. These are expensive and aren't readily available to people who do not have an auto repair shop. Furthermore, the key's housing must be replaced as well which could add to the overall costs of making the replacement key for your car.

Depending on the car key type, you may also need to purchase replacement parts. For instance, certain key fobs have features such as panic and remote lock/unlock buttons that can add to overall costs. Some key fobs also require batteries that can be costly to replace.

It is recommended to create an extra car key before you lose the original one. This will ease the stress of losing your keys and will ensure that you always have a functioning backup. If you do end up needing a new key, try to find an auto dealer or locksmith with the right equipment to work with your car. It will cost less than purchasing a new key from a dealer and you can avoid the high fees that come with this option.

If you have an ignition key that requires programming, it's important to keep a record of your immobilizer code or key number in case you need to be able to reprogramme it later. This information is usually located on your registration or title and can be provided to a locksmith or auto dealer for a small fee.

Cost of replacing keys

Depending on the make and model of your car You may need to purchase replacement keys from a dealer or an automotive locksmith. Examine the key in your vehicle to determine if it is equipped with an electronic car key replacement transponder or smart key chip. These technologies can raise the cost of replacing your car's keys.

A traditional car that doesn't have a keyfob is affordable and can be duplicated at the local hardware store for less than $25. It's a good idea have a backup in the event that you lose your original.

Most modern cars come with the key fob that emits an electrical signal to unlock and start your vehicle. It can be a hassle to replace when it's lost in the event that you lose it, since you'll need to contact the manufacturer to obtain a new one and pair it with your vehicle. The cost of an alternative key fob ranges from $50 to $125.

In some cases you can replace a keyfob at the dealership if you have evidence of ownership, like a registration or title. However, the dealer may charge an additional cost to cover travel expenses and time spent in remote locations. Alternately, you can purchase an aftermarket key online or even directly from the vehicle manufacturer. This is a cheaper option, however it is more risky since the quality of these keys can't be guaranteed.
